The Moose Jaw and District Food Bank first experienced plumbing issues on March 6, which resulted in the temporary suspension of services.

The cause of the plumbing issues was determined to be damaged sewer and water lines running to the building leaving the non-profit on the hook for a $30,000 repair bill.

Repairs to the sewer and water system began on the morning of March 13, and the community has rallied in support of the food bank.

The Mosaic Company donated $15,000 or half of the total repair bill, and as of this morning, donations from the community have amounted to $23,895. 

The food bank is looking to reopen on Friday, March 15th, and to extend their hours on that day for their clients.
